In the menu … WebApr 12, 2024 · To bring up the Screen Capture menu, you have to press Shift+Ctrl+Show Windows. The Show Windows key is on the top row of the keyboard, and its icon looks like a window with two more windows behind it. Just press these three buttons, and the menu will appear at the bottom of the screen. Also, you can press Ctrl+Show Windows to quickly …

When you screenshot on Windows 11 or Windows 10 using this method, the operating system saves … thick rice krispie treatsWebApr 12, 2024 · Press the Print Screen key, also called PrtScn, on any Surface laptop right away to take a picture. Windows copies the picture to the Clipboard. Once the picture is in the Clipboard, you can paste it into any image editor, document, or social media site.
